About Sanford Country Club

Sanford Country Club is a premier golf destination located in Sanford, Maine, near the scenic New Hampshire and Maine coastline. The club features a historic 18-hole golf course that has hosted prestigious events like the US Amateur Qualifying Round. With four sets of tees, the course caters to golfers of all skill levels. In summary

Sanford Country Club is frequently praised for its excellent course conditions, challenging layout, and friendly, accommodating staff. Many visitors appreciate the well-maintained greens and fairways, as well as the welcoming atmosphere at the clubhouse and bar. However, some guests have experienced issues with staff interactions and course management, such as slow pace of play and cart availability, which have impacted their overall experience.
